An antigenic determinant, a internet site about the antigen which the immune process responds to by building antibody, can commonly be just one unique framework around the antigen. In hen egg white lysozyme, a glutamine at place 121 (Gln 121) protrudes faraway from the antigen floor. In this watch, Gln 121 is circled. The antibody is just not proven. The subsequent photos clearly show how this aspect is essential to the formation of the significant affinity antibody-antigen interactions.


The antibody's HV region sorts an opening to surround the antigen's protruding Gln 121 (environmentally friendly). Hydrogen bonds (yellow) stabilize the antibody-antigen interaction. Together with hydrogen bonds, other weak interactions these kinds of as van der Waals forces, hydrophobic interactions and electrostatic forces enhance the binding specificity among antibody and antigen. These interactions occur more than substantial and from time to time discontinuous areas in the molecules, improving upon binding affinity. The animation displays amino acids of the antibody that interact with Gln 121.


Animation: Gln 121 of lysozyme surrounded by amino acid residues of antibody


Close-up of the hydrogen bond - The Tyr 101 in the antibody sorts a hydrogen bond while using the Gln 121 in the antigen.

Water molecules (light-weight blue) fill in spaces between the antigen and the antibody. The drinking water molecules lead considerably into the binding vitality by developing supplemental hydrogen bonds.


Molecular structures represented in this tutorial ended up received by X-ray crystallography. The coordinates for these structures are registered with the Protein Facts Lender (1FYA and 1FYB).
